Incised signature lower left, 'A. Sacerdote' for Anselmo Sacerdote (Italian, 1868-1923), titled, lower right, 'Val Soana' and dated August, 1903. Anselmo Sacerdote was born in Turin and first apprenticed in the studio of Vittorio Avondo, the director of the Museo Civico of Turin, (predecessor of the present Museo Civico d'Arte Antica). From 1903, Sacerdote exhibited at both the Società Promotrice delle Belle Arti and with the Turinese Circle of Artists. He was later appointed the secretary-conservator at the Museo Civico d'Arte Antica, a position that he held for 23 years. Sacerdote was influenced by academic landscape painters including Lorenzo Delleani and the so-called School of Rivara. This latter group painted outdoors on scene, and were interested in capturing fleeting atmospheric seasons, times, and weather of the mountains and valleys. Among his colleagues who specialized in painting the Piedmontese alpine valleys, were Vittorio Cavalleri, Giovanni Colmo, and Carlo Pollonera. An early camera enthusiast, Sacerdote often took pictures to help him work up his painting in the studio. The area of the North-Western Italian Alps where the artist liked to paint is now home to the Gran Paradiso National Park. A protected area, it is home to many protected species including ibex and chamois.
